Understanding Biosensor Technology

A biosensor is an analytical device that detects biological information and converts it into measurable signals. These devices typically consist of three main components:

Bioreceptor: Detects specific biological molecules such as enzymes, antibodies, DNA, or cells.
Transducer: Converts biological interactions into electrical, optical, or chemical signals.
Signal Processing System: Analyzes and displays the results.

Biosensors can detect various biological parameters, including:

Glucose levels
Blood pressure indicators
Biomarkers
Pathogens
Hormones
Chemical compounds

Their ability to provide fast and accurate measurements makes them valuable across multiple industries.

Nanotechnology Driving Biosensor Innovation

Nanotechnology is significantly improving biosensor sensitivity and performance. Nanomaterials such as graphene, nanoparticles, and nanowires enable faster and more accurate detection.

Advantages of nanotechnology-based biosensors include:

Higher sensitivity
Faster response times
Smaller device size
Improved detection accuracy

These advancements are supporting the development of next-generation biosensors for medical diagnostics and wearable applications.
